HIV/AIDS Statistics for Ecuador

Total population in thousands (2007): 13,341*
Number of people living with HIV (2007): 26,000*
Adults aged 15 to 49 prevalence rate (2007): 0.3*
Adults aged 15 and up living with HIV (2007): 25,000*
Women aged 15 and up living with HIV (2007): 7,100*
Deaths due to AIDS (2007): 1,400*
Estimated antiretroviral therapy coverage (Dec 2007): 42%



Ongoing biomedical HIV prevention research trials in Ecuador

Pre-Exposure Prophylaxis

Trial: Pre-Exposure Prophylaxis Initiative [iPrEx]
Phase: III
Product Being Tested: Daily oral TDF/FTC (Truvada®)
Sponsor, funder, developer, collaborator: National Institute of Health, Bill and Melinda Gates Foundation, Fenway Community Health, San Francisco Department of Public Health
Total participants: 2,499
Countries: Brazil, Ecuador, Peru, South Africa, Thailand, US
Trial sites in US: Boston, MA
